Making a pawsitive impact: VolkerLaser team supports RSPCA Worcester
On Wednesday 29 of April, five VolkerLaser colleagues spent the day volunteering at RSPCA Worcester.
Supporting local communities is important to us as a business, with every VolkerLaser employee getting one day per year to volunteer for an organisation of their choice.
The RSPCA Worcester, based in Kempsey, opened in 2016 as an animal rehoming centre. The charity rescue, rehabilitate, and rehome, cats, dogs, rabbits and other small animals within Worcester and the surrounding areas.
The day began with an overview of the centre, followed by a safety briefing and a tour of the site. The team then got stuck into a wide range of tasks, including painting fences, litter picking, cleaning the cattery corridors, and weeding and levelling gravel. One of our colleagues even brought along his own lawn mower to cut the grass and kindly stayed behind to make sure the job was fully completed.
The team had a brilliant time and worked extremely hard during their visit to complete all the tasks at hand.
